The Utility of Performance-Based Downloads

Standard listening tracks are often useless in a professional environment. They lack the extended intro and outro sections necessary for long, smooth blends. A professional toolkit prioritizes DJ edits. These versions provide eight-bar or sixteen-bar percussion headers that allow for creative layering. High-energy assets like Partybreakz are equally essential. They act as energy bridges, using vocal hype and rhythmic shifts to transition between genres or BPM ranges without losing the crowd. Software Compatibility: Ensuring Your Downloads Work Everywhere

Technical reliability is non-negotiable. Your library must function across all major platforms, including Serato DJ, Rekordbox, and Traktor. This starts with file format. Always prioritize 320kbps MP3s or lossless WAV files. These formats provide the necessary headroom for large-scale sound systems without the digital artifacts found in low-bitrate rips. Avoid DRM-protected files. Nothing kills a set faster than a "file not supported" error because a subscription license failed to check in. Your assets must be locally stored, high-bitrate, and universally compatible to ensure you're ready for any booth, regardless of the hardware provided.

Sound EFX: Beyond the Basics

Generic sound clips won't cut it in a high-pressure environment. You need professional-grade Sound EFX that cut through the mix. Heavy bass drops and high-energy risers are your primary tools for signaling a drop or masking a difficult transition. If you're playing Reggae or Dancehall, authentic sound system FX like sirens and laser shots are non-negotiable for credibility. Map these sounds to your performance pads or a dedicated FX bank in your software. This ensures instant trigger access so you can add flair without fumbling through folders mid-set.

Metadata Standards for Professional DJs

Consistency is king. Use "Dancehall 90s" across every file rather than mixing it with "90s Dancehall." This prevents fragmented search results during a live set. Use the Comment fields for energy levels on a scale of 1 to 5 or specific descriptors like "Heavy Bass" or "Vocal Hype." It's a fast way to filter for exactly what the room needs in real time. For professional club systems, 320kbps is the absolute industry minimum to ensure your audio doesn't clip or distort at high volumes.

How to Source and Download High-Quality DJ Assets

Strategic sourcing is what separates a professional from a hobbyist. You can't rely on generic, royalty-free tracks for a high-pressure club environment. You need a systematic approach to acquiring dj toolkit music downloads that actually work on a large-scale sound system. Start by auditing your current library to identify critical gaps. If you're booked for a throwback night and realize you're missing definitive 2000s urban hits, that's your first priority. Don't hoard music; download with intent.

Once gaps are identified, choose your sourcing model. Individual packs work for specific needs, but a comprehensive membership offers long-term library expansion. Before any track enters your master collection, verify the technical specs. Check for 320kbps bitrate and ensure the metadata is clean. Finally, test every new download on a high-output system. Desktop speakers often mask clipping or low-end loss that will ruin a set on a club rig. Technical vetting is a mandatory part of your workflow.

  • Step 1: Audit your library to find missing genre essentials.
  • Step 2: Decide between a specialized pack or a recurring membership.
  • Step 3: Verify bitrate and metadata consistency.
  • Step 4: Run a sound check on a loud system to ensure audio integrity.

Record Pools vs. Curated Music Bundles

Record pools are effective for staying current with weekly radio releases. However, they often lack historical depth and specialized curation. If you need a foundation of "evergreen" hits, curated music bundles are superior. They provide a pre-selected core library that defines specific eras or genres without the filler found in massive pools. A one-time pack purchase offers immediate ownership of a specialized crate, while a membership acts as a silent partner for constant growth. Evaluate your budget; a subscription is a recurring expense, whereas a high-quality pack is a permanent asset for your performance-ready library.

Why should I download music packs instead of using streaming services?

Local downloads provide the reliability that streaming services can't guarantee in a high-pressure booth. Streaming requires a stable internet connection and often limits your access to specific performance edits like short cuts or hype remixes. Owning your library ensures zero latency and allows you to use pre-analyzed files with set cue points. Performance-ready packs are engineered for club systems, offering superior audio headroom compared to standard streaming bitrates.
